From 1 July 2025, skilled visa income thresholds will rise by 4.6%, in line with annual wage growth (AWOTE).
Income thresholds are indexed annually so wages for skilled migrants increase at the same rate as Australian workers. This ensures that people cannot use skilled migration to undercut Australian workers.
From 1 July 2025, indexation changes will be as follows:
Income Threshold | Increased | Impacted Subclasses |
The Core Skills Income Threshold (CSIT) | From $73,150 to $76,515 | Core Skills stream of SC 482 and SC 186 |
Specialist Skills Income Threshold (SSIT) | From $135,000 to $141,210 | Specialist Skills stream of SC 482 |
Temporary Skilled Migration Income Threshold (TSMIT) | From $73,150 to 76,515 | SC 494 and SC 187 |
New nominations from 1 July 2025 must meet the new threshold or market salary rate, whichever is higher.
Existing visa holders and nominations lodged before 1 July 2025 are not affected.
